Low 25uVrms Noise Linear Regulator Paralleled for Higher Output Current -  The LT1762 series are micropower, low noise, low dropout regulators.  The devices are capable of supplying 150mA of output current with a dropout voltage of 270mV.  Designed for use in battery-powered systems, the low 25μA quiescent current makes them an ideal choice.  Quiescent current is well controlled; it does not rise in__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Apr 22, 2011

Low Noise Low Ripple Triple Output Supply Providing 1V, 8A & 1.8V, 5A & 1.5V, 3A -  The LT3070 is a low voltage, UltraFast transient response linear regulator.  The device supplies up to 5A of output current with a typical dropout voltage of 85mV.  A 0.01μF reference bypass capacitor decreases output voltage noise to 25μVRMS.  The LT3070’s high bandwidth permits the use of low ESR ceramic capacitors, saving__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Apr 22, 2011

Low Noise Varactor Biasing with Switching Regulator -  AN85 Telecommunication, satellite links and set-top boxes all require tuning a high frequency oscillation.  The actual tuning element, a varactor diode, requires high voltage bias for operation.  The high voltage bias must be free of noise to prevent unwanted oscillator outputs__ Linear Technology/Analog Devices

LT3009 3μA IQ, 20mA Low Dropout Linear Regulators-Video Product Brief -  The LT3009 Series are micropower, low dropout voltage (LDO) linear regulators.  The devices supply 20mA output current with a dropout voltage of 280mV.  No-load quiescent current is 3μA.  Ground pin current remains at less than 5% of output current as load increases.  in shutdown, quiescent current is less than 1μA.  __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Tony Armstrong-Director of Product Marketing Dec 7th 2009

LT3015 1.5A, Low Noise, Negative LDO with Precision Current Limit-Video Product Brief -  The LT®3015 series are low noise, low dropout, negative linear regulators with fast transient response.  The devices supply up to 1.5A of output current at a typical dropout voltage of 310mV.  Operating quiescent current is typically 1.1mA and drops to < 1μA in shutdown.  Quiescent current is also well controlled in dropout.  __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Steve Knoth-Senior Product Marketing Engineer Mar 25th 2013

LT3070 5A, Low Noise, Digitally Programmable Output, 85mV LDO Regulator-Video Product Brief -  The LT3070 is a low voltage, UltraFast™ transient response linear regulator.  The device supplies up to 5A of output current with a typical dropout voltage of 85mV.  A 0.01μF reference bypass capacitor decreases output voltage noise to 25μVRMS.  The LT3070’s high bandwidth permits the use of low ESR ceramic capacitors, saving__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Steve Knoth-Senior Product Marketing Engineer Jun 29th 2010

LT3080 Adjustable 1.1A Single Resistor Low Dropout Regulator-Video Product Brief -  The LT3080 is a 1.1A low dropout linear regulator that can be paralleled to increase output current or spread heat in surface mounted boards.  Architected as a precision current source and voltage follower allows this new regulator to be used in many applications requiring high current, adjustability to zero, and no heat sink.  __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Steve Knoth-Senior Product Marketing Engineer Nov 18th 2009

LT3081 1.5A Single Resistor Rugged Linear Regulator with Monitors-Video Product Brief -  The LT3081 is a 1.5A low dropout linear regulator designed for rugged industrial applications with monitoring and protection features.  Key features of the device are the extended safe operating area, wide input and output voltage ranges, output current monitor, temperature monitor and programmable current limit.  The LT3081__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Steve Knoth-Senior Product Marketing Engineer Jul 30th 2013

LT6110-Cable/Wire Drop Compensator with LT1965 Linear Regulator -  Click Here For A Ready To Run LTspice Circuit Demonstration The LT®6110 is a precision high side current sense with a current mode output, designed for controlling the output voltage of an adjustable power supply or voltage regulator.  This can be used to compensate for drops in voltage at a remote load due to resistance __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Greg Zimmer Oct 17th 2013

LT8705 80V VIN / VOUT Synchronous 4-Switch Buck-Boost DC/DC Controller-Video Product Brief -  The LT®8705 is a high performance buck-boost switching regulator controller that operates from input voltages above, below or equal to the output voltage.  The part has integrated input current, input voltage, output current and output voltage feedback loops.  With a wide 2.8V to 80V input and 1.3V to 80V output range, the__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Bruce Haug-Senior Product Marketing Engineer Jun 11th 2013

LTC3129 15V, 200mA Synchronous Buck-Boost Converter with 1.3uA Iq-Video Product Brief -  The LTC®3129-1 is a high efficiency, 200mA buck-boost DC/DC converter with a wide ViN and VOUT range.  it includes an accurate RUN pin threshold to allow predictable regulator turn-on and a maximum power point control (MPPC) capability that ensures maximum power extraction from non-ideal power sources such as photovoltaic__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Bruce Haug-Senior Product Marketing Engineer Sep 23, 2013

LTC3375 8-Ch Programmable, Parallelable 1A Buck PMIC-Video Product Brief -  The LTC®3375 is a digitally programmable high efficiency multioutput power supply IC .  The DC/DCs consist of eight synchronous buck converters (iOUT up to 1A each) all powered from independent 2.25V to 5.5V input supplies.  DC/DC enables, output voltages, operating modes, and phasing may all be independently programmed over__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Steve Knoth-Senior Product Marketing Engineer Mar 25th 2013

LTC3676 8-Output PMIC for Application Processors-Video Product Brief -  The LTC®3676 is a complete power management solution for advanced portable application processor-based systems.  The device contains four synchronous step-down DC/DC converters for core, memory, i/O, and system on-chip (SoC) rails and three 300mA LDO regulators for low noise analog supplies.  The LTC3676-1 has a ±1.5A __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Steve Knoth-Senior Product Marketing Engineer, Power Products Oct 24th 2013

LTC3863 60V Low IQ Inverting DC/DC Controller-Video Product Brief -  The LTC®3863 is a robust, inverting DC/DC PMOS controller optimized for automotive and industrial applications.  it drives a P-channel power MOSFET to generate a negative output and requires just a single inductor to complete the circuit.  Output voltages from –0.4V to –150V are typically achievable with higher__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Bruce Haug-Senior Product Marketing Engineer Jun 11th 2013

LTC3866 Current Mode Synchronous Controller for Sub Milliohm DCR Sensing-Video Product Brief -  The LTC®3866 is a single phase current mode synchronous step-down switching regulator controller that drives all N-channel power MOSFET switches.  it employs a unique architecture which enhances the signal-to-noise ratio of the current sense signal, allowing the use of a very low DC resistance power inductor to maximize the__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Bruce Haug-Product Marketing Engineer May 2, 2012

LTC4222 μTCA Application Supplying 12V Payload Power to Two μTCA Slots -  The LTC4222 Hot Swap controller allows two power paths to be safely inserted and removed from a live backplane.  Using external N-channel pass transistors, board supply voltages and inrush currents are ramped up at an adjustable rate.  An i2C interface and onboard ADC allows for monitoring of current, voltage and fault status __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Mar 26th 2010

LTC4225 μTCA Application Supplying 12V Power to Two μTCA Slots -  The LTC4225 offers ideal diode and Hot Swap functions for two power rails by controlling external series connected N-channel MOSFETs.  MOSFETs acting as ideal diodes replace two high power Schottky diodes and the associated heat sinks, saving power and board area.  Hot Swap control MOSFETs allow boards to be safely inserted __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Apr 22, 2011

LTC4360/LTC4361/LTC4362 Overvoltage / Overcurrent Protection Controllers-Video Product Brief -  The LTC4360/LTC4361/LTC4362 overvoltage/overcurrent protection controllers safeguard 2.5V to 5.5V systems from input supply overvoltages and overcurrents.  They are designed for portable devices with multiple power supply options including wall adapters, car battery adapters and USB ports.  The LTC4360 controls an external __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Alison Steer-Product Marketing Manager Aug 25th 2010

LTM4620 Dual 13A Regulator -  This circuit shows a simplified block diagram of the LTM4620 μModule regulator in a dual output design.  its two internal high performance synchronous buck regulators produce 1.2V and 1.5V rails, each with 13A load current capability.  The input voltage range is 4.5V to 16V.  __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Oct 3, 2012

LTM4620 Efficiency -  Measuring the efficiency of the LTM4620 with Vin = 12, Vout = 1.2V.  At 100A load current, efficiency is above 83%.  __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Aug 15th 2012

LTM4620 Short Protection -  Demonstration of short circuit protection of the LTM4620.  With the output shorted to ground, both current and temperature are controlled.  The circuit recovers when the short circuit is removed.  __ Linear Technology/Analog Devices App Note, Aug 15th 2012
